Test plan — Stormrelay fan-out, security pass.

Scope: verify alert fan-out to 10k simulated subscribers does not leak subscriber metadata across tenants. Cases: duplicate-delivery suppression, expired-subscription rejection, malformed-payload handling, replay of signed alerts older than 60s. All fan-out triggers go through the staging publish endpoint; unsigned requests must return 401. Load harness runs from the Kestrelbay cluster. The harness authenticates to staging with the bearer token below.

login token, kajef-bageg: eyJhbGciOiJIUzI1NiIsInR5cCI6IkpXVCJ9.eyJzdWIiOiIH5ZQCtYjwtIn0.4vgGyGsw5y_7

// Heads up, support folks: this constant pins the version of Brickbat, our
// shared component library. If a customer screenshot shows a mismatched button
// style, odds are their tenant is on an older pin. Don't bump this casually —
// check with the design-systems crew first. The currently deployed build is
// noted just below.

session token of kageg-tahop = htk14_af3c1ccccb7dcf

Q: I'm on night shift and a Nordquist Systems engineer needs into our cage at the Halverton data centre — what do I do? A: Confirm the visit is listed on the overnight access sheet and check photo ID against the booking. Escort the engineer to Cage 14 and remain within sight for the duration. Log entry and exit times in the night book. The cage turnstile does not accept standard building badges, so you will need the code below.

staff pass of kawip-hawef = bdg-QLP-2

## Alert: StatRelay Sidecar Flush Lag

This alert fires when the StatRelay metrics-aggregation sidecar falls more than 120 seconds behind on flushing buffered samples to the Coalmine backend. Plugin-emitted counters are buffered in-process, so sustained lag usually means a plugin is emitting unbounded label cardinality or blocking the flush thread. Check your plugin's metric registration against the published cardinality limits before escalating. If the lag persists after your plugin is ruled out, contact the telemetry team.

escalation mailbox, bagug-fahof: novdor.wendor.jormir@norvalabs.example